What Can Marketers Learn from an Innovation Powerhouse?
Xerox PARC. The name is synonymous with “innovation”. Since it’s founding in 1970, this research center has pumped out a wealth of ground-breaking inventions: laser printing, Ethernet, the graphical user interface (GUI), object-oriented computing, and so much more.
